What does a Mobile Heavy Equipment Mechanics, Except Engine do?

Here are the core responsibilities you can expect as a Mobile Heavy Equipment Mechanics, Except Engine:

  • Repair and replace damaged or worn parts.
  • Test mechanical products and equipment after repair or assembly to ensure proper performance and compliance with manufacturers' specifications.
  • Operate and inspect machines or heavy equipment to diagnose defects.
  • Read and understand operating manuals, blueprints, and technical drawings.
  • Dismantle and reassemble heavy equipment using hoists and hand tools.

How do I write a great Mobile Heavy Equipment Mechanics, Except Engine resume?

Creating an effective Mobile Heavy Equipment Mechanics, Except Engine resume requires focusing on what employers in Maintenance value most.

Use relevant keywords

ATS systems scan for specific terms. Include these keywords naturally throughout your resume:

RepairingMicrosoft WordTroubleshootingMicrosoft ExcelMicrosoft OutlookEquipment MaintenanceOperations MonitoringMicrosoft Office software

Quantify your impact

When describing how you "repair and replace damaged or worn parts", include metrics like percentages, team sizes, budgets, or project scope to demonstrate real results.

Showcase technical proficiency

Highlight hands-on experience with Microsoft Office software, Microsoft Word, Microsoft Excel and any mechanical certifications that validate your expertise.

Match the experience level

For Mobile Heavy Equipment Mechanics, Except Engine roles, employers typically expect usually requires trade school, apprenticeship, or 2-year degree. Highlight matching qualifications prominently at the top of your resume.

Do

  • +Highlight experience testing equipment post-repair per manufacturer specifications.
  • +Detail specific heavy equipment operation for diagnostic purposes in maintenance roles.
  • +Mention database software proficiency for tracking parts inventory and repair histories.

Don't

  • -List engine-specific repair tasks unrelated to mobile heavy equipment systems.
  • -Use vague descriptions instead of concrete repair and part replacement examples.
  • -Omit Microsoft Excel skills needed for maintaining equipment service logs.

How to use AI to improve your Mobile Heavy Equipment Mechanics, Except Engine resume

AI tools like ChatGPT can be incredibly helpful when crafting your Mobile Heavy Equipment Mechanics, Except Engine resume. They can help you brainstorm achievements, rephrase bullet points for impact, identify missing keywords, and tailor your content to specific job descriptions.

However, AI is not perfect. Always proofread the output carefully. AI can sometimes make factual errors, use generic language, or miss the nuances of your specific experience. Think of AI as a helpful assistant, not a replacement for your own judgment.
